2005 Saturn Relay AWDSECTION Installation Procedure
- Install a new gasket, if necessary.
- Install the throttle body assembly.
- Install the throttle body nuts and the bolts.
Tighten: Tighten the nuts and the bolts to 10 N.m (89 lb in).
- Install the heater inlet pipe. Refer to Heater Hose/Pipe Replacement - Inlet/Outlet in Heating, Ventilation and Air Conditioning.
- Install the heater pipe nut to the throttle body.
Tighten: Tighten the nut to 25 N.m (18 lb ft).
- Connect the ETC electrical connector (1) to the throttle body (2).
- Install the air cleaner intake duct. Refer to Air Cleaner Intake Duct Replacement .

When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
